- The distance between Dibrugarh/ Mohanbari, India and Springfield, Missouri, Usa is approximately 12,765 km or 7,933 mi.
- To reach Dibrugarh/ Mohanbari in this distance one would set out from Springfield, Missouri bearing 351.8° or N and follow the great circles arc to approach Dibrugarh/ Mohanbari bearing 187.4° or S .
- Dibrugarh/ Mohanbari has a humid subtropical climate with dry winters (Cwa) whereas Springfield, Missouri has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a).
- Dibrugarh/ Mohanbari is in or near the subtropical wet forest biome whereas Springfield, Missouri is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ome.
- The annual average temperature is 9.9 °C (17.8°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 13.6 °C (24.5°F) less in Dibrugarh/ Mohanbari. The continentality subtype is truly oceanic as opposed to subcontinental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 1475.6 mm (58.1 in) more which is equivalent to 1475.6 l/m² (36.21 US gal/ft²) or 14,756,000 l/ha (1,577,514 US gal/ac) more. About 2 1/3 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 9.7° higher in Dibrugarh/ Mohanbari than in Springfield, Missouri.
- Relative humidity levels are 20.6% higher.
- The mean dew point temperature is 14°C (25.2°F) higher.
